Roanoke Upsets Women's Soccer

LYNCHBURG, Va. - Sixth-seeded Roanoke scored the game's lone goal in the second half on its way to a 1-0 upset victory over second-seeded Shenandoah Saturday afternoon in the ODAC Women's Soccer Tournament semi-finals.

Lauren O'Brien finished off a Linnea Kremer cross in the 77th minute to give Roanoke (11-7-2) the upset win over Shenandoah (13-7-1).

The goal completed a contest in which the Maroons took 15 of the game's 21 shots, including 10 of 13 in the first half.

The two teams split 10 corner kicks.

Shenandoah keeper Erin Septer had seven saves to help keep her side in it.

"We battled but got outplayed today," Hornets coach Liz Pike said.

"We had a great season but were beaten by a better team this afternoon."

The upset victory sends RC into Sunday's 2:30 championship game against top-seeded Lynchburg. LC defeated fourth-seeded Virginia Wesleyan 4-0 in the first semi-final of the day.

Shenandoah will announce its 2015 schedule in January.
